Exploring Emotion, Nature, and Identity with Tom Hartman Tom Hartman is back and he has delivered something truly special. His latest release, I've Been Away, is a deeply personal and moving song that speaks to something we all feel — our connection to the natural world. Blending folk, blues, and alt-country into one beautiful sound, the track paints a hopeful picture of a future where people live more humbly alongside nature. The inspiration behind the song is just as captivating as the music itself. During a visit to Switzerland, surrounded by stunning landscapes and a breathtaking waterfall, Hartman began reflecting on what we have lost by replacing natural spaces with human-made environments. That honest reflection became the soul of I've Been Away. The production is nothing short of stunning. Intricate 12-string guitar work, warm atmospheric reverb, and the rich sound of a traditional African calabash come together to create a dreamlike listening experience that stays with you long after the song ends. This is more than a song. It is a love letter to the Earth, an exploration of human emotion, and a bold statement of artistic vision. With new releases and live performances on the horizon, Tom Hartman is clearly just getting started. Do not miss what comes next. What story or emotion were you trying to share with this song? To me, this song is a dream beyond humanity’s destructive nature. It’s an ode to hope for a utopia in which that strange destructiveness is controlled, wrapped in a love song towards ‘Mother Earth’. Can you take us back to the moment when you first knew you had to write this track? What sparked it? I had a date at a waterfall, and the scenery was so beautiful that it definitely did something to me. I go into detail on that matter a couple of questions later. The phrase “I've Been Away” can mean so many things. What does it represent for you in this song? To me, this phrase means a brief moment lost in thought — a future dream. In that dream, we as humans redeem our humble position towards the planet we live on. What was your creative process like? My creative process always starts with a jam based on a feeling, and then fine-tuning the lyrics around that feeling. After that, I select the tempo of the track and record a ‘guide track’, which is a live version of the song with guitar and vocals recorded to a metronome. Around that track, all the instruments and vocals are added. Was there a specific experience or period in your life that inspired “I've Been Away”? I was working as a DJ in Switzerland, where the nature is so inspiring; it felt almost holy to me and made me humble. You can see this reflected in the culture of the people there as well. In Holland, I live in a city where our surroundings — the environment — are completely under our control; almost an enslavement of ‘nature’, one could say. What was the most challenging or rewarding part of creating this song from start to finish? The song is based on fingerpicking on a 12-string guitar, which was quite tricky to master. How does “I've Been Away” fit into your overall sound and artistic vision as Tom Hartman? The sonic vision of this project is based on folk ’n blues/alt-country, using a lot of rhythmic guitar playing, different percussion elements, and harmonica hooks. I think my audience consists of people who value storytelling, emotional vulnerability, and genuineness in the music they listen to. This song is made for those who are curious about themselves, exploring their identities and complex emotions. Were there any particular instruments, sounds, or production choices that helped capture the vibe you were going for? There are different elements in this release where both the 12-string guitar and the ambient reverb on that guitar represent the dream. The percussion was done on a calabash, which is a traditional African instrument. This provides an additional “back to our roots” atmosphere as another layer of that dream. Looking ahead, what can fans expect next from you? Does “I've Been Away” hint at what's coming? It definitely does! There are multiple releases planned for 2026, all using folk/country sonics to explore the complexity of our emotions. Besides that, gigs are planned throughout the Netherlands this summer, with the prospect of a small European tour later this year or next year.
